Reduced Commercial Liquid Waste and Decreased Diseases Untreated liquid waste treatment seeps into the earth, damaging groundwater utilised in farming operations. It can impede plant development and result in crop failures. Improper discharge into sources of water endangers marine and aquatic organisms. It can also damage a city's pipeline network since it includes several harmful compounds. If liquid waste overflows, it can damage critical infrastructure. Liquid waste emits poisonous vapours into the atmosphere. Humans and animals who breathe these vapours may develop a variety of respiratory illnesses. Understanding Liquid Waste Management: Terminology and Constraints Liquid waste includes a wide range of waste kinds, from wastewater from homes to industrial effluents. It encompasses all liquid waste generated by families, business entities, industry, and agricultural operations. Managing this waste is critical for minimising water pollution, conserving aquatic life, and protecting public health. However, dealing with liquid waste involves several complications. The variability of waste composition needs unique treatment procedures for each waste type.
